What is Meteosource?

Meteosource is a weather-tech company consisting of both meteorologists and IT experts that was launched back in 2007. Meteosource has been providing professional weather data and applied modelling for multiple clients - small as well as large companies.
To deliver our accurate weather data at cost-effective prices, we have built a new service that allows you to receive weather data for each point on the globe via the easiest, most advanced weather API on the web.

What is the source of the data?

We provide data for any GPS coordinate using our proprietary machine learning model which is based on different weather models. We cooperate with other weather services around the globe as well as producing a vast amount of data by ourselves to provide services with superior accuracy and stability.

How often is data updated?

Our current data and forecasts are updated in real time to reflect the most up-to-date weather information. This is usually at least once every 10 minutes for land areas.

Can I use Meteosource's API for commercial purposes?

Yes, you can use our products and data for non-commercial or commercial purposes as long as visible credit is given to Meteosource as a weather data provider in a prominent part of your application.
The Free/Trial subscriptions are only available for non-commercial use.

How do I use my API key and what is an API request?

You can locate your API key after logging in to your account. You need to add your API key to the URL parameter to authorise a request from your application and process it appropriately.
One API request is consumed each time you call Meteosource weather API to obtain information on the weather. Pricing is based on the number of free daily API requests allowed.

What happens if I exceed my free calls limit?

You can enable/disable the ‘pay as you go’ option (see our pricing). Enabling this option will ensure you receive get API responses within your API rate limit. If the option is not activated and you reach your daily limit, requests will be denied until the rate quota resets at 00:00 UTC.
